STANDARD DATA DICTIONARY #8985.1 -- XTID VUID FOR SET OF CODES FILE 3/24/25 PAGE 1 STORED IN ^XTID(8985.1, (942 ENTRIES) SITE: WWW.BMIRWIN.COM UCI: VISTA,VISTA (VERSION 7.3) DATA NAME GLOBAL DATA ELEMENT TITLE LOCATION TYPE ----------------------------------------------------------------------------------------------------------------------------------- This file is used to associate a VHA Unique ID (VUID) to each of the elements in a Set of Codes, effectively associating a standard reference term with a non-standard reference term. DD ACCESS: @ RD ACCESS: @ WR ACCESS: @ DEL ACCESS: @ LAYGO ACCESS: @ AUDIT ACCESS: @ PRIMARY KEY: A (#57) Uniqueness Index: B (#570) File, Field: 1) FILE NUMBER (8985.1,.01) 2) FIELD NUMBER (8985.1,.02) 3) INTERNAL REFERENCE (8985.1,.03) INDEXED BY: FILE NUMBER & FIELD NUMBER & INTERNAL REFERENCE (B), VUID & FILE NUMBER & FIELD NUMBER & MASTER ENTRY FOR VUID (C) 8985.1,.01 FILE NUMBER 0;1 FREE TEXT (Required) (Key field) INPUT TRANSFORM: K:$L(X)>30!($L(X)<1) X LAST EDITED: FEB 17, 2005 HELP-PROMPT: Answer must be a valid VistA file number or subfile number. DESCRIPTION: The file number or subfile number assigned in VistA where the Set of Codes exists. TECHNICAL DESCR: The number of the file or subfile that contains a field of type SET OF CODES. PRE-LOOKUP: I $G(DUZ(0))'="@" K X DELETE AUTHORITY: UNEDITABLE NOTES: XXXX--CAN'T BE ALTERED EXCEPT BY PROGRAMMER RECORD INDEXES: B (#570), C (#571) 8985.1,.02 FIELD NUMBER 0;2 FREE TEXT (Required) (Key field) INPUT TRANSFORM: K:$L(X)>30!($L(X)<1) X LAST EDITED: FEB 17, 2005 HELP-PROMPT: Answer must be a valid field number in the VistA file/subfile. DESCRIPTION: The field number assigned to a field in a VistA file or subfile that contains a Set of Codes. TECHNICAL DESCR: A field with a SET OF CODES as its type. UNEDITABLE NOTES: XXXX--CAN'T BE ALTERED EXCEPT BY PROGRAMMER RECORD INDEXES: B (#570), C (#571) 8985.1,.03 INTERNAL REFERENCE 0;3 FREE TEXT (Required) (Key field) INPUT TRANSFORM: K:$L(X)>50!($L(X)<1) X LAST EDITED: FEB 17, 2005 HELP-PROMPT: Answer must be a valid internal value in the Set of Codes for this field. DESCRIPTION: An internal value used by the Set of Codes. TECHNICAL DESCR: The internal value used by the set of codes for the field indicated in the FIELD NUMBER field. UNEDITABLE NOTES: XXXX--CAN'T BE ALTERED EXCEPT BY PROGRAMMER RECORD INDEXES: B (#570) 8985.1,99.98 MASTER ENTRY FOR VUID VUID;2 SET (Required) '0' FOR NO; '1' FOR YES; LAST EDITED: FEB 17, 2005 DESCRIPTION: This field identifies the Master entry for a VUID associated with a Term/Concept. UNEDITABLE RECORD INDEXES: C (#571) 8985.1,99.99 VUID VUID;1 FREE TEXT (Required) INPUT TRANSFORM: S X=+X K:$L(X)>20!($L(X)<1)!'(X?1.18N) X LAST EDITED: FEB 17, 2005 HELP-PROMPT: Answer must be 1-20 characters in length. DESCRIPTION: VHA Unique ID (VUID). A unique meaningless integer assigned to reference terms VHA wide. UNEDITABLE NOTES: XXXX--CAN'T BE ALTERED EXCEPT BY PROGRAMMER RECORD INDEXES: C (#571) 8985.1,99.991 EFFECTIVE DATE/TIME TERMSTATUS;0 DATE Multiple #8985.11 (Add New Entry without Asking) DESCRIPTION: Describes the pair Status and Effective Date/Time for each reference term. PRIMARY KEY: A (#58) Uniqueness Index: B (#572) File, Field: 1) EFFECTIVE DATE/TIME (8985.11,.01) INDEXED BY: EFFECTIVE DATE/TIME (B) 8985.11,.01 EFFECTIVE DATE/TIME 0;1 DATE (Required) (Key field) INPUT TRANSFORM: S %DT="ESTX" D ^%DT S X=Y K:Y<1 X LAST EDITED: FEB 17, 2005 DESCRIPTION: This is the date/time when the Status of the reference term was established. UNEDITABLE FIELD INDEX: B (#572) REGULAR IR LOOKUP & SORTING Unique for: Key A (#58), File #8985.11 Short Descr: Uniqueness Index for Key 'A' of Subfile #8985.11 Set Logic: S ^XTID(8985.1,DA(1),"TERMSTATUS","B",X,DA)="" Kill Logic: K ^XTID(8985.1,DA(1),"TERMSTATUS","B",X,DA) Whole Kill: K ^XTID(8985.1,DA(1),"TERMSTATUS","B") X(1): EFFECTIVE DATE/TIME (8985.11,.01) (Subscr 1) 8985.11,.02 STATUS 0;2 SET (Required) '0' FOR INACTIVE; '1' FOR ACTIVE; LAST EDITED: JAN 27, 2005 DESCRIPTION: The Status of a reference term is either 'ACTIVE' or 'INACTIVE'. If 'ACTIVE', then the term will be accessible by end-users to document a particular patient event. If 'INACTIVE', then the term will only be accessible by the application to display legacy data. UNEDITABLE File #8985.1 Record Indexes: B (#570) RECORD REGULAR IR LOOKUP & SORTING Unique for: Key A (#57), File #8985.1 Short Descr: Used to ensure uniqueness of reference terms for set of codes Set Logic: S ^XTID(8985.1,"B",X(1),X(2),X(3),DA)="" Kill Logic: K ^XTID(8985.1,"B",X(1),X(2),X(3),DA) Whole Kill: K ^XTID(8985.1,"B") X(1): FILE NUMBER (8985.1,.01) (Subscr 1) X(2): FIELD NUMBER (8985.1,.02) (Subscr 2) X(3): INTERNAL REFERENCE (8985.1,.03) (Subscr 3) C (#571) RECORD REGULAR IR LOOKUP & SORTING Short Descr: Used for locating reference terms by VUID and can indicate the master entry Set Logic: S ^XTID(8985.1,"C",$E(X(1),1,20),$E(X(2),1,30),$E(X(3),1,30),$E(X(4),1,1),DA)="" Kill Logic: K ^XTID(8985.1,"C",$E(X(1),1,20),$E(X(2),1,30),$E(X(3),1,30),$E(X(4),1,1),DA) Whole Kill: K ^XTID(8985.1,"C") X(1): VUID (8985.1,99.99) (Subscr 1) (Len 20) (forwards) X(2): FILE NUMBER (8985.1,.01) (Subscr 2) (Len 30) (forwards) X(3): FIELD NUMBER (8985.1,.02) (Subscr 3) (Len 30) (forwards) X(4): MASTER ENTRY FOR VUID (8985.1,99.98) (Subscr 4) (Len 1) (forwards) INPUT TEMPLATE(S): PRINT TEMPLATE(S): SORT TEMPLATE(S): FORM(S)/BLOCK(S):